Online platforms offering Viagra often require a consultation with a doctor. This usually involves completing a medical questionnaire detailing your health history, current medications, and any existing conditions. Be honest and thorough in completing this questionnaire; inaccurate information can compromise your health.
The doctor reviews your questionnaire to assess your suitability for Viagra. They may request additional information or a video consultation to further evaluate your health. This process ensures the medication is appropriate for your individual needs and minimizes potential risks.
Following a successful consultation, a prescription will be issued if the doctor deems it safe. The online platform will then typically dispense the medication, often directly to your address. Note that specific requirements and processes vary depending on the online pharmacy and your location. Check the specific policies of each platform before using their services.
Remember: Always check the legitimacy of online pharmacies before providing personal or medical information. Look for verified licensing and secure payment options. If something feels wrong, contact your primary care physician for guidance.
